Williston Financial Group (WFG) is the Portland, Oregon-based parent company of several national title insurance and settlement services providers, including WFG Lender Services and WFG National Title Insurance Company. One of only six national underwriters, WFG achieved a national footprint faster than any title insurance provider in history. The WFG family of companies offers full-service title insurance and settlement services for use in residential and commercial mortgage and real estate transactions nationwide. Job Purpose:

The National Escrow Advisor is responsible for monitoring regulatory and legislative changes, as well as reviewing and implementing best practices in the settlement services industry across the country. The National Escrow Advisor will make recommendations to Executive Management regarding settlement services. This role will provide guidance to escrow managers and staff regarding escrow best practices, as well as company escrow policies and procedures applicable to escrow operations across the country.

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:



  • Thorough understanding of escrow law, local city and state requirements.

  • Thorough understanding of RESPA, TILA, Dodd-Frank and CFPB rules.

  • Thorough understanding and adoption of ALTA Best Practices.

  • Familiarity with Microsoft Office Suite and escrow production software e.g. ResWare, RamQuest, AtClose, IClosings and/or others.
